    The Rise of Telehealth: Healthcare Beyond Boundaries

    Telehealth, one of the most visible innovative healthcare solutions, has exploded in recent years, especially after the pandemic. But it's way more than just video calls with your doctor. Telehealth now includes a whole bunch of cool stuff like remote patient monitoring, wearable tech integration, and even AI-powered chatbots for basic medical advice. What's amazing is how telehealth is breaking down the geographical barriers. You can connect with specialists, get prescriptions, and manage chronic conditions without leaving your house. This is a game-changer for people in rural areas, folks with mobility issues, and anyone who just values convenience. This new era of healthcare helps you take charge of your health on your own terms. Telehealth platforms are also becoming super user-friendly, offering features like secure messaging, appointment scheduling, and access to your medical records, so you are always in touch with the information you need. Many people consider telehealth the future of healthcare. Telehealth has already made healthcare so accessible and convenient, and there's a lot more innovation coming down the pipeline. We can expect even more personalized and proactive care as telehealth technologies continue to evolve.

    AI in Healthcare: Smarter Medicine

    Artificial Intelligence (AI) is already making a huge impact on innovative healthcare solutions, especially in diagnosis, treatment, and drug discovery. AI algorithms can analyze medical images (like X-rays and MRIs) with incredible speed and accuracy, helping doctors spot diseases earlier. AI is also being used to personalize treatment plans based on a patient's genetic makeup, lifestyle, and medical history. This is the future of medicine, where treatments are tailor-made for each individual. AI is also being employed to accelerate the drug discovery process. AI can analyze vast amounts of data to identify potential drug candidates, predict their effectiveness, and even optimize clinical trials, speeding up the process of bringing new medicines to market. One area that's getting a lot of attention is AI-powered chatbots that can provide initial medical advice, answer basic questions, and even triage patients, helping to free up doctors' time for more complex cases. AI is not just about replacing doctors; it's about giving them powerful new tools to work with. AI can handle the repetitive and data-intensive tasks, allowing doctors to focus on what they do best: providing compassionate care and making critical decisions. AI has the potential to transform healthcare in a lot of ways, from making diagnosis more accurate to speeding up drug development. But it's also important to address the ethical considerations and ensure that AI is used responsibly to improve the experience of healthcare for everyone.

    Wearable Technology and Remote Patient Monitoring

    Wearable tech isn't just for tracking your steps anymore. These devices, including smartwatches, fitness trackers, and even smart clothing, are packed with sensors that can monitor vital signs, sleep patterns, and even detect early signs of illness. This constant stream of data allows doctors to monitor patients remotely, catching potential problems before they become serious. Remote patient monitoring is especially beneficial for people with chronic conditions like diabetes or heart disease, helping them manage their health from home and reducing the need for frequent hospital visits. Wearable technology is making healthcare more proactive. It's not just about reacting to illness; it's about preventing it. By providing real-time data on a patient's health, these devices empower individuals to take control of their well-being. This technology is creating new data. They are generating huge amounts of health data. This information can be analyzed using AI and machine learning to identify trends, predict health risks, and develop more effective treatments. Wearable tech and remote patient monitoring are important parts of innovative healthcare solutions, improving patient outcomes and revolutionizing how we approach healthcare. Wearable technology is changing the healthcare landscape, improving how we take care of our health.

    Gene Editing and Precision Medicine

    Gene editing technologies, especially CRISPR, are opening up unprecedented possibilities in treating genetic diseases. CRISPR allows scientists to precisely modify genes, potentially correcting the root causes of conditions like cystic fibrosis and sickle cell anemia. Precision medicine takes this a step further. It uses genetic information, lifestyle data, and environmental factors to tailor medical treatments to the individual patient. This means that doctors can choose the most effective treatments for a specific patient, based on their unique characteristics. This is a big deal, as it can significantly improve treatment outcomes and reduce side effects. This area is constantly advancing, with researchers finding new ways to edit genes, and doctors are getting better at using genetic information to guide treatment decisions. Precision medicine is about treating the individual, not just the disease. Gene editing and precision medicine are transforming healthcare, offering the promise of cures and more effective treatments. While gene editing and precision medicine are amazing, we must think about the ethical considerations, accessibility, and regulation of these new technologies. They require careful oversight to make sure they're used safely and equitably.

    Blockchain in Healthcare: Secure Data Management

    Blockchain, the technology behind cryptocurrencies, is also making its mark on healthcare. In healthcare, blockchain is being used to create secure and transparent systems for managing medical records, ensuring patient data privacy and preventing fraud. Because blockchain creates an immutable record of transactions, it's perfect for tracking the movement of drugs and medical supplies, ensuring authenticity and preventing counterfeiting. Blockchain can also improve interoperability between different healthcare providers. This means doctors, hospitals, and pharmacies can share information more easily and securely, leading to better coordination of care. This will also help simplify administrative tasks. Blockchain technology is helping us create a more efficient, secure, and patient-centered healthcare system. It can also help us improve data security, protect patient privacy, and ensure the integrity of medical information. Blockchain is still in its early stages in healthcare, but it holds great promise for the future. As blockchain technology evolves, it will be even easier to implement and integrate into healthcare systems.
